["Mash avocados and add lime juice in a glass or ceramic container", "Using a blender or Cuisinart - blend together the Half and Half and Sugar- add the Heavy Cream then follow with the Avocado- Lime mash- Blend till smooth and thick-return to the bowl- hand incorporate ""druplets"" ( the little juicy spheres that make up the berry ) then refrigerate till cold -", "Transfer to a freezer safe container and let freeze till ready to serve or in 1 hr you can remove, re-blend, return to freezer ( thus creating more of a gelato than ice cream)", "When ready to serve - let stand for 5 min so you are able to create the perfect scoop ! Garnish the serving vessel with Mint Leaves and drizzle with ""druplets"" and whole raspberries - aux complet ! Bon Appetite !"]
